Okay, wait, forget those resolutions, let's eat now. I'm standing right in a different restaurant, and the vibe is like being in South Korea. The writing is very unfamiliar, but I often see it in K-dramas. 1988 sounds like the title of a comedy K-drama I like.

The inside is really similar to the South Korean street food I see on television, and all the menu items here are alcohol-free. Like this brewed drink, the bottle resembles soju, but it's only Yakult, aka Yogurt Drink.

We ordered some interesting and familiar dishes: odeng, toppoki, and Korean grilled chicken. They were all red with gocchujang, right? I thought I'd have a stomach ache from the bloating and spiciness, but that was just my imagination.

IMG_2453.jpeg

IMG_2457.jpeg

The taste ia sweet and spicy, but not overpowering. The gocchujang really good with a flavor that's already popular with Indonesians. I thought it can be authentic, but unfortunately it's not. My favorite thing about all the dishes? Of course, the cheese and chicken dipping, but the odeng was no less interesting. The odeng really delicious and good taste, chewy but the fish flavor didn't fade, and it was quite good compared to all the odeng I've had. Honestly, I'd go back if I want something different.

IMG_2469.jpeg

IMG_2456.jpeg

The vibe was engaging, the service was good, and the food was served quickly! However, it wasn't very busy when I went, and you know why? It's quite expensive. Honestly, if we shared it would have been very cheap and worth it, but since the two of us ate this much food, it was a shame that I didn't bring 2 more people to enjoy the South Korean food in my city.
